Registered Nurse

Sentara Heart Hospital Advanced Heart Failure Unit
Norfolk, VA
09.2016 - 02.2019
  • Specialized training in the care of patients with advanced stages of heart failure (EF < 20%), including, but not limited to, patients who will receive or have received a left ventricular assistive device (LVAD) or heart transplant. Provide meticulous education to patients and patient caregivers regarding the maintenance of LVAD or heart transplant, including, but not limited to, medication management, signs and symptoms of malfunction or rejection of the organ or device, and when to seek medical treatment. Includes the care of patients with postpartum cardiomyopathy, ischemic cardiomyopathy, and non-ischemic cardiomyopathy.
  • Specialized training in the care of patients with pulmonary arterial hypertension. Provide treatment and care for patients with the disease process, and teach newly diagnosed patients and their caregivers the use of at-home intravenous or subcutaneous medication management, signs and symptoms of disease progression, medication failure, and when to seek medical treatment.
  • Monitor up to three intermediate care or two low-critical-care patients, updating information on vital signs, changes in patient condition, and progress of treatment.
  • Document data related to patients' care, including, but not limited to: assessment results, interventions to promote the healing process, medication administration, patient responses to treatment, or treatment changes.
    • Assessed the condition of patients, ordering and evaluating diagnostic tests as needed, in collaboration with other members of the healthcare team.
    • Ability to titrate various intravenous medications, such as Bumex, dobutamine, dopamine, heparin, Lasix, milrinone, nitroglycerin, octreotide, Remodulin, and Veletri.
    • Ability to care for central venous lines (CVL), post-op wounds, including open heart surgery, and various dressing changes due to the LVAD.
    • Preceptor to new graduate registered nurses.
